<P>PROBLEM TO BE SOLVED: To provide an apparatus and a method for recovering lithium from a solution obtained by leaching a fired product including a positive electrode material of a lithium ion secondary battery with water, and containing ions of lithium and fluorine, sulfuric acid, etc., by continuously and simultaneously purifying and concentrating lithium. <P>SOLUTION: An electrolytic cell is partitioned between an insoluble anode and a cathode with a plurality of diaphragms to keep concentration differences between cations and anions in the partitioned chambers, and while uniform concentration is kept in each chamber, a concentration gradient of ions is maintained from the anode side to the cathode side. A stock solution is supplied to a chamber near the middle to extract a lithium ion concentrate from a chamber nearest the cathode of high lithium ion concentration, and to discharge an impurity concentrate from a chamber nearest the anode of high impurity ion concentration. <P>COPYRIGHT: (C)2013,JPO&INPIT |
